About

Drupal is a modular open-source content management platform written in PHP.

It provides over 50,000 modules for adding and customizing its functionality, flexible content types, multilingual support, RESTful API integration, and built-in user roles and permissions for managing complex websites.

phpComasy is a content management system developed by the Swiss company Indual GmbH, tailored primarily for municipalities and small-to-medium enterprises.

It offers a modular architecture with specific extensions for event management and reservations, features a simplified editor for non-technical users, and provides integrated tools for search engine optimization and responsive mobile display.
